    "content": "From: Yunjian Wang <wangyunjian@huawei.com>\n\nThe variables 'vfio_res->nb_maps' and 'i' are of type int. The type\ncasting of 'vfio_res->nb_maps' is redundant and not required.\n\nSigned-off-by: Yunjian Wang <wangyunjian@huawei.com>\n---\n drivers/bus/pci/linux/pci_vfio.c | 6 +++---\n 1 file changed, 3 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)",
    "diff": "diff --git a/drivers/bus/pci/linux/pci_vfio.c b/drivers/bus/pci/linux/pci_vfio.c\nindex c15ed3bad..85a51e3e2 100644\n--- a/drivers/bus/pci/linux/pci_vfio.c\n+++ b/drivers/bus/pci/linux/pci_vfio.c\n@@ -750,7 +750,7 @@ pci_vfio_map_resource_primary(struct rte_pci_device *dev)\n \t\t}\n \t}\n \n-\tfor (i = 0; i < (int) vfio_res->nb_maps; i++) {\n+\tfor (i = 0; i < vfio_res->nb_maps; i++) {\n \t\tstruct vfio_region_info *reg = NULL;\n \t\tvoid *bar_addr;\n \n@@ -875,7 +875,7 @@ pci_vfio_map_resource_secondary(struct rte_pci_device *dev)\n \t/* map BARs */\n \tmaps = vfio_res->maps;\n \n-\tfor (i = 0; i < (int) vfio_res->nb_maps; i++) {\n+\tfor (i = 0; i < vfio_res->nb_maps; i++) {\n \t\tret = pci_vfio_mmap_bar(vfio_dev_fd, vfio_res, i, MAP_FIXED);\n \t\tif (ret < 0) {\n \t\t\tRTE_LOG(ERR, EAL, \"  %s mapping BAR%i failed: %s\\n\",\n@@ -934,7 +934,7 @@ find_and_unmap_vfio_resource(struct mapped_pci_res_list *vfio_res_list,\n \t\tpci_addr);\n \n \tmaps = vfio_res->maps;\n-\tfor (i = 0; i < (int) vfio_res->nb_maps; i++) {\n+\tfor (i = 0; i < vfio_res->nb_maps; i++) {\n \n \t\t/*\n \t\t * We do not need to be aware of MSI-X table BAR mappings as\n",
